The Department of Health Policy and Management in the UGA College of Public Health is located in Wright Hall on the UGA Health Sciences Campus in the Normaltown neighborhood of Athens, Ga.

The building is named for LTJG Robert F. Wright, a World War II flying hero and native of Athens, Ga.  The building, built in 1971 when the campus was home the U.S. Navy Supply Corps School, honors LT Wright, who never returned from a night mission launched from the USS Enterprise in the Southeast Pacific in January 1945.
